
The tolerance zone is the approximate location
of a underground utility facility defined by a strip of land at least 3 feet
wide, but not wider than the underground utility facility plus 1 1/2 feet on
either side of such facility based upon the markings made by the owner or
operator of the facility.
Excavation within the tolerance zone required hand-digging using extreme care and caution. (See Section 2.7 of the Illinois Underground Utility Facilities Damage Prevention Act.)
